Analysis

Tajikistan recorded 142,880 t for all crops — burning crop residues in 2050.

Over the whole period, all crops — burning crop residues in Tajikistan peaked at 175,150 t in 2005 and was at its lowest, 88,030 t, in 1994.

That places Tajikistan 108th out of 183 countries with data for 2050, putting it in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 34 years of available data.

The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ions from Crops provides estimates of emissions associated with crop processes, namely 1) crop residues, 2) burning of crop residues, and 3) rice cultivation and the application of nitrogen (N) fertilizers, including mineral and chemical fertilizers, to soils. Estimates are computed at Tier 1 following the 2006 IPCC Guidelines for National greenhouse gas (GHG) Inventories (IPCC, 2006).
